Israel has carried out intense airstrikes on southern Lebanon, killing one person, wounding seven and briefly cutting a highway link to Beirut.

The pre-dawn attacks on the village of Msayleh on Saturday struck a place that sold heavy machinery, destroying a large number of vehicles, the Health Ministry said.

A vehicle carrying vegetables that happened to be passing by at the time of the strikes was also hit, killing one person and wounding another, according to Hezbollah's Al-Manar TV.

The Health Ministry later said that victim was a Syrian citizen, while the wounded were a Syrian national and six Lebanese, including two women.

The Israeli military said it struck a place where machinery was stored to be used to rebuild infrastructure for the Hezbollah militant group.
